How Refinance Mortgage Lenders Actually Work
Refinancing means replacing an existing mortgage with a new loan, typically to secure better terms. The process begins with evaluating eligibility based on credit, income, and property value. Lenders then analyze current interest rates and loan structures to propose updated terms—such as a lower rate or shorter repayment period. Unlike traditional mortgage origination, refinance lenders focus heavily on prepayment analysis, helping borrowers minimize total interest costs. The process is fully digital in most cases, with lenders coordinating through closed-loop systems to streamline documentation and loan approvals—ideal for mobile-first users seeking speed and simplicity.

How long does refinancing take?
Most refinances are completed in 30 to 45 days, from application to closing, depending on documentation speed and loan type.
